Athens, W.Va. – The Concord University softball team plays two Mountain East Conference doubleheaders on the road against West Liberty and Wheeling this weekend.
Concord travels to West Liberty to take on the Hilltoppers Sunday at 2:00 p.m. at Hilltopper Softball Complex. CU will then play Wheeling on Monday at 12:00 p.m. at JB Chambers I-470 Complex.

RECORDS
Concord is 10-24 overall and 3-11 against MEC teams.
West Liberty has an overall record of 19-12-1 and conference record of 9-3.
Wheeling is 9-18 overall and 2-10 against MEC opponents.
CLEAN SWEEP
Wednesday evening, Concord defeated Glenville State in both games of their MEC doubleheader. The Mountain Lions beat the Pioneers 2-0 in game one and 7-3 in game two. In the first game, senior pitcher/outfielder
Laura Thompson's RBI double in the bottom of the third inning opened the scoring for the game. Freshman utility player
Delaney Fulk made it a 2-0 game by scoring on a wild pitch. Freshman pitcher/first baseman
Caitlyn Bauer was dominant in the win. Bauer pitched all seven innings, striking out a career-high 10 batters, allowing zero earned runs, and facing just two batters over the minimum.
In game two, freshman shortstop/utility player
Courtney Raines batted 2-for-3 with two RBI. L. Thompson, senior third baseman/outfielder
Sarah Thompson, and freshman first baseman/outfielder
Kassidy Garvey recorded an RBI each in the game. Freshman pitcher/infielder
Rachael Koller was the winning pitcher in the contest. Koller pitched a complete game, striking out seven batters and allowing three earned runs.
The last time the Mountain Lions swept a MEC opponent was against Davis & Elkins in the 2021 regular season finale. CU took game one 5-3 before defeating D&E 9-0 in game two. In game one, L. Thompson batted 3-for-3 with two doubles and two RBI. She also earned the win in the circle, striking out three batters in a complete game effort. Junior catcher/outfielder
Jolie Privett tallied two hits with two RBI in the game. In game two against D&E, S. Thompson batted 3-for-3 with two doubles, two RBI, and three runs scored. L. Thompson tripled and scored once in the game. The Mountain Lions had a total of nine hits in the contest.
BRINGING THE HEAT
Bauer's ten strikeouts against Emory & Henry is the third time this season and 11
th time in the last three seasons that a Mountain Lion pitcher has fanned 10 opponents in a single game. Koller has struck out 10 batters twice so far this season. Bauer has tossed a team-high 84 strikeouts so far this season. Her 84 strikeouts is the sixth-most in the Mountain East. The Lexington, North Carolina native also is currently sitting in sixth for the most strikeouts in a single season by a CU pitcher.

HISTORY AGAINST WEST LIBERTY/WHEELING
Concord is 19-33 all-time against West Liberty and 15-20 all-time against Wheeling. CU's 8-6 win over West Liberty in 2019 is the last time the Mountain Lions beat the Hilltoppers. Concord had 10 hits as a team in the game.
Last season, CU swept Wheeling by beating the Cardinals 7-3 in game one and 8-0 in game two. Privett and S. Thompson tallied two hits in game one. S. Thompson also had two RBI and a double in the win. L. Thompson earned the win in the circle, pitching a complete game with nine strikeouts. In game two, L. Thompson tripled and recorded two RBI in the win.
WEST LIBERTY AT A GLANCE
The Hilltoppers have won three of their last four games. WLU has a team batting average of .280. Annie Paterson leads West Liberty in batting average (.469), slugging percentage (.827), doubles (11), home runs (six), and RBI (25). West Liberty has three pitchers in the top-5 in the MEC in ERA. Taylor Bonnett is tied for first in the MEC with a 1.25 ERA. Makenzie Amend is third in the conference with a 1.76 ERA. Paterson is fourth in the MEC with a 2.61 ERA. West Liberty's team-ERA is 2.38. Amend is second in the MEC in strikeouts with 112.
WHEELING AT A GLANCE
Wheeling is currently on a nine-game losing streak. The Cardinals' two conference wins have come against Notre Dame and Alderson Broaddus. Wheeling has a team batting average of .298 and slugging percentage of .440. Autumn Oehlstrom leads the team in batting average (.406) and slugging percentage (.681). Wheeling's team ERA is 7.81. Aubrie Lafferty leads the Cardinals with 23 strikeouts in 49.1 innings pitched.
